CV0-004 Cloud Architecture and Design Practice Question
A company runs a web application on AWS EC2 instances behind an Application Load Balancer. They want to handle traffic spikes automatically. Which scaling approach should they implement?

Correct answer & explanation
✓
Auto-scaling
Auto-scaling adds or removes instances based on metrics like CPU utilization, handling traffic spikes automatically.

Option-by-option breakdown
For each option: why learners choose it and why it is or isn't the right answer here.
- ✗
Vertical scaling
Why it's wrong here
Vertical scaling increases instance size but requires downtime and does not auto-scale.
- ✓
Auto-scaling
Why this is correct
Auto-scaling automatically adjusts capacity based on defined metrics.
- ✗
Manual scaling
Why it's wrong here
Manual scaling requires human intervention and cannot react automatically to spikes.
- ✗
Horizontal scaling
Why it's wrong here
Horizontal scaling adds instances but without automation it does not handle spikes automatically.
